Key Features and Requirements of the Dental Electronic Claims Enrollment Form

Filling out the Dental Electronic Claims Enrollment Form requires specific information to ensure successful submission. Key fields include the Provider/Organization Name, Tax Identification Number, and National Provider Identifier (NPI) number. Additionally, submitting medical billing software details and signing the form are crucial steps in the process.
  • Provider/Organization Name
  • Tax Identification Number
  • NPI Number
  • Signature section with signing requirements
Ensuring all sections of the form are completed accurately is vital for seamless processing of claims.

The Dental Electronic Claims Enrollment Form is designed for dental providers who wish to enroll in electronic claims submissions with Horizon Healthcare Dental Services. It is essential for those with an active practice.
Before completing the form, gather essential information such as your Provider/Organization Name, Tax Identification Number or Social Security Number, NPI number, and practice management software details to ensure accurate completion.
After filling out the form, you can submit it via mail or fax to the specified address or fax number provided in the instructions. If using pdfFiller, follow the prompts for electronic submission.
Common mistakes include missing required fields, providing incorrect information, or failing to sign the form. Pay careful attention to the instructions to avoid delays in processing your claims.
Processing times can vary. After submission, contact Horizon Healthcare Dental Services for information on expected timelines. Generally, expect to wait several business days for processing.
No, notarization is not required for the Dental Electronic Claims Enrollment Form. You only need to provide your signature in the designated area.
Once submitted, you generally cannot make changes to the form. If corrections are needed, contact Horizon Healthcare Dental Services for guidance on how to proceed.
